PINEAPPLE CHEESE BALL



Pineapple Cheese Ball image

I received this recipe from a friend at work. Love this recipe because it is delicious and works up in a few minutes. Just the right touch of sweet vs. savory. Cook time is actually refrigerator time.

Provided by Jellyqueen

Categories     Spreads

Time 12h10m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 (8 ounce) packages softened cream cheese
1 (8 ounce) can crushed pineapple, drained
2 cups finely chopped pecans, divided into two one cup portions
1/4 cup finely chopped green bell pepper
2 tablespoons grated onions or 2 tablespoons finely chopped green onions
2 teaspoons seasoning salt (I use Lawry's)
cracker, of choice

Steps:

  • Mix all the ingredients, using only 1 cup of the pecans listed and form into a ball.
  • Reserve 2nd cup of pecans for topping.
  • Refrigerate overnight.
  • Before serving, roll cheese ball in reserved cup of pecans.
  • Serve with crackers of choice.

PINEAPPLE CHEESE BALL



Pineapple Cheese Ball image

Sweet and savory pineapple cheese ball is a unique, delicious party appetizer. Guests love it! Cream cheese, crushed pineapple, bell pepper and crunchy pecans.

Provided by Erin Clarke / Well Plated

Categories     Appetizer

Time 1h23m

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 cups raw pecan halves
2 (8-ounce) packages reduced fat cream cheese (softened to room temperature)
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
Pinch cayenne pepper
1 (8-ounce) can crushed pineapple
1 small red bell pepper (finely chopped (about 1 cup))
1/4 cup minced green onions (plus additional for garnish)
Crackers ((our family loves Triscuits or Ritz))
Toasted baguette slices

Steps:

  • Toast the pecans: pre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Spread the pecans in a single layer on an ungreased baking sheet. Bake until toasted and fragrant, about 8 to 10 minutes, stirring once halfway through. DO NOT WALK AWAY. Nuts love to burn at the last second. Let cool, then chop go for a medium chop, a little bit finer than rough chopped (but they certainly don't need to be microscopic pieces).
  • In a large mixing bowl, beat the cream cheese with the garlic powder, salt, and cayenne until smooth and combined.
  • By hand, stir in the pineapple, bell pepper, and green onion.
  • Add half of the chopped pecans.
  • Lay a large sheet of plastic wrap on the counter. Scrape the cheese pineapple mixture into the center in as globe-like of a mound as you can. It will not be a perfect sphere at this point.
  • Wrap the edges of the plastic around it to seal and encourage it to form a round ball. Place the wrapped cream cheese in a bowl and refrigerate for at least 1 hour or overnight.
  • When ready to serve, remove the chilled cheese ball from the refrigerator. Place the chopped pecans on a plate. (I find it's easiest to use a plate with edges that curve up a little. A pie dish works well too.) Unwrap the cheese ball and place it on the plate with the pecans, coating well. The cheese ball won't roll like a real ball. Gently lift and turn it, patting the pecans all over the outside. Carefully transfer it to a serving plate. Serve with crackers or baguette slices and a sprinkle of additional green onion for garnish.

PINEAPPLE CHEESE BALL



Pineapple Cheese Ball image

Canned pineapple gives this cheese ball a little extra flavor and sweetness. I recently brought this cheese ball to a party and even those who claim not to like pineapple were raving about how good it was and said it was "addicting". This recipe makes two cheese balls, however, you may want to only take one cheese ball to your next party and keep the second for you and your family, as I'm sure there will not be any leftovers. I typically do not roll the the cheese ball in nuts, but do so if you wish.

Provided by mcknelly1

Categories     Spreads

Time 10m

Yield 16 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 (8 ounce) packages cream cheese, softened
1 cup minced celery
1/2 cup chopped green bell pepper
1 teaspoon minced onion
1 (20 ounce) can crushed pineapple, drained
1 cup chopped pecans (optional)

Steps:

  • 1. Be sure to drain the pineapple really well, otherwise it may turn out more like a dip rather than a cheese ball.
  • 2. Combine cream cheese, celery, bell pepper, onion, and crushed pineapple.
  • 3. Divide the mixture in half and shape into two balls.
  • 4. If desired, roll each ball in pecans.
  • 5. Chill several hours or overnight.
  • 6. Serve with crackers.
